Discharge anomaly (Refer to DGN = 909 to 914 [861 to 868]
Pressing the HVON (start discharge) button causes the unit to start
discharging. This alarm is issued, if at least one discharge tube fails to
operate.
No. Cause of trouble Solution
1 Anomaly of parameter set-
ting
Make a setting using the values of PRM.
No. 15220 [0247], 15221 [0248], 15241
[0237], 15222 [0249], 15223 [0250]
listed in the parameter table attached to
the machine.
2 Anomaly of laser gas com-
position
Replace the laser gas with the specified
one, that is CO
2
:N
2
:He = 5:55:40% (vol-
ume ratio) with a composition ratio accu-
racy of "5% or less.
Also make sure that gas does not leak
from the external laser gas pipe.
3 Loose fixing parts of elec-
trode
It is necessary to replace or adjust the
part. Call the FANUC service center.
4 Gas circulating system leak-
age of gas or water
5 The gas flow control value
is closed
Overheat of laser cabinet (Refer to DGN = 961/bit 1 [841/bit7])
The temperature of the input side of the electrode cooling fan is monitored
and sends alarm when it exceeds 60°C. When the temperature decreases,
the alarm state is solved automatically. Before that it cannot be reset.
No. Cause of trouble Solution
1 Excessive environmental
temperature
Lower the ambient temperature by ven-
tilation (5°C to 30°C).
2 Excessive cooling water
temperature
Check the temperature adjuster of the
chiller unit. Set the temperature of the
cooling water to within an appropriate
range (20°C to 30°C).
3 Anomaly of cooling fan mo-
tor
It is necessary to replace or adjust the
part. Call the FANUC service center.
4 Anomaly of temperature
sensor
5 Oscillator IF PCB or CNC IF
PCB abnormal
6 Anomaly of connecting
cables between the PCBs.
